but .. the reaction of cedar & copper is a little overblown
i've seen copper get corroded in valleys.. but it was usually in a high wear area due to erosion..
so .. a concentrated flow area might be of concern.. but a general flow.. like a drip edge... or a ridge flash... or an apron... no.. i wouldn't worry about the reaction.. i'd worry about erosion.. i'd worry about good details that allow for thermal expansion
damn... cedar & copper have been the standard for about three hundred years.. why should they all of a sudden decide they are reactive ?
i do know that in areas of concern... lead -coat was always the standard solution... Mike Smith Rhode Island : Design / Build / Repair / Restore

I don't know if I'm understanding this correctly or not.... sounds like a rubber membrane roof that you're flashing in? (I'm picturing counterflashing to cover termination bars, etc...)
If so, and the orig galv lasted 40 years....your new membrane will need replacing (15-20 yrs) long before the galv wears out again. With CU prices as they are today, galvanized might be by far the best value (plus you can go with a multitude of color choices).
Aluminum would also have a fine lifespan with a membrane roof (as long as you use aluminum or stainless fasteners with it, not steel).
I pay for copper flashings ONLY when I'm also buying a roofing system with the same lifespan (Slate, rheinzinc, flat seam copper, etc...).

"1)Where does one find copper flashing?"
Here in the Northeast the stuff is just about everywhere. Even HD stocks it. For a lot less money, you can now get the 3 oz paper backed-copper. Around here, every place seems to be stocking that now (even HD and Lowes) because it works with PT lumber. This would certainly be adequate for some areas given your flashing has redundance. Would not work for drip edges or complex shapes though.
"3)Is there a better, lower cost flashing for wall trim?"
Don't now about better, but you can now get vinyl roll flashing that takes a bend. Certainly cheaper. Limited color selection. Can be painted.
There is always aluminum and lead. Aluminum is relatively cheap, and pretty easy to work. Lead is very easy to work with, turns a nice unobtrusive dark color, and can be a particularly good choice for a sidewall to roof transitions.
"I'm using rubber membrane, but I'd rather the blue surface not show above trimmed openings and belly and base bands."
If by this you mean sticky membrane material (such as Vycor, etc.), these are generally not rated for UV exposure, so while they are great for backup, they should be covered with flashing material.

Per "Installing Cedar Siding", published in 1993 by the Western Red Cedar Lumber Association (http://www.wrcla.org/about_us/brochuresandpublications_html/technical_literature/pdf/installingsiding.pdf), "Flashing should be made from a corrosion-resistant material such as galvanized steel or aluminum. Copper flashing may be used above exposed cedar siding. However, the use of copper where rainwater has first traversed exposed cedar siding can cause deterioration of the flashing."

>>>>>>>>>>>>...and the story continues. The booklet was revised in 2001 and the last two sentences I quoted above were eliminated. What does this mean?The tanic (tannic?) acid in cedar is corrosive to copper. Around here, where copper valleys are used, the areas right below the keyways dumping onto the copper stay shiney. I'm guessing that since cedar (old growth) roofs used to last a lot longer than they do now, the roof may have outlived the flashings. 20 years seems to be the max on a cedar roof now, so the copper flashings may last longer than the cedar. Take a look at the Western Red Cedar Lumber Association's website (http://www.wrcla.org). You'll find that they specifically don't recommend using copper flashings below cedar siding. Cedar's tannins corrode it relatively quickly. Nearly every other flashing material imaginable is permitted, even lead-coated copper.
